Hedy Lamarr (guest host); Kingsmen; Joe Tex; Dave Clark 5

Season 2Episode 1130 minOct 21, 1965
Hedy Lamarr (guest host); Kingsmen; Joe Tex; Dave Clark 5
Opening medley: (1) The Shindig Band, the Blossoms, the Kingsmen, Eddie Rambeau and Joe Tex – ""Treat Her Right"" (2) The Kingsmen – ""Too Much Monkey Business"" Other songs/guests (not in broadcast order): --Eddie Rambeau – ""Concrete and Clay"" and ""The Train"" --Joe Tex – ""I Want To"" and ""I Got A Woman"" --Brenda Holloway – ""Shake"" and ""You Can Cry on My Shoulder"" --The Kingsmen – ""Money,"" ""Louie Louie"" and a medley (""Jolly Green Giant,"" ""Annie Fannie"" & ""Little Latin Lupe Lu"") --Dave Clark Five – ""Having A Wild Weekend"" --Finale: The Kingsmen, Joe Tex, Brenda Holloway, Eddie Rambeau - ""Do You Love Me"" (with closing credits)
Hedy Lamarr (guest host); Kingsmen; Joe Tex; Dave Clark 5 has aired on Oct 21, 1965 at 7:30 PM
